Hackers Selling Database of 4 Million Adult Friend Finder Users at $16,800. Email addresses, sexual orientations, and other sensitive details from about 3.9 Million Adult Friend Finder online hookup service are currently available for sale for 70 Bitcoins (around $16,800/€15,300) on an underground website. Yes, the sex life of almost 4 million subscribers of the casual sex hookup site is now available for anyone to download from the Internet. Adult Friend Finder website , with a tagline " Hookup, Find Sex or Meet Someone Hot Now ," has been breached before April 13 in which nearly 4 Million users have had their personal details compromised. The details include subscribers' user names, email addresses, dates of birth, gender, sexual orientation, postal codes, and IP addresses, which is a treasure trove for online spammers and phishers. Until now, hackers have targeted companies and websites that hold your credit card details or medical information, but now they are showing interest in your sex life instead. You heard it right. Adult Friend Finder , a casual dating website with the tagline "hookup, find sex or meet someone hot now", has suffered a massive data breach. Nearly 4 Million users of AdultFriendFinder have had their personal details, including email addresses, usernames, dates of birth, postcodes and IP addresses, exposed on the dark web for sale online. The Channel 4 news site broke the story on Thursday and warned users of the California-based dating site with 64 million members who want to have sex and one night stands with strangers. Nearly 4 Million Sex Life Exposed. The leaked data also includes the information on whether the users are gay or straight and even which ones might be seeking extramarital affairs.
